Dubai Government announces changes to the working week across its departments

The Government of Dubai has announced that it will transition to a four-and-a-half day working week, effective from 1 January 2022.

The decision complies with the new system adopted by the UAE Federal Government.

According to the decision, the working week extends from Monday to Thursday. Friday will be a half day. The new weekend will fall on Saturday and Sunday.

The move is aligned with Dubai’s vision to strengthen its economic competitiveness globally and consolidate its status as a regional and international business hub. The decision also seeks to enhance quality of life, boost productivity and enhance work-life balance in the emirate.

The official working hours based on the new system will be 7:30 am to 3:30 pm from Monday to Thursday (eight hours of work) and 7:30 am to 12:00 pm on Friday (four and a half hours of work).
